    Greetings all.

    This is my first visit. I have been tinkering with wood for a while on my own. Didn't know this forum existed. The examples of workmanship( or should that be personship) are very impressive. I can see that I still have a long way to go.

    Does anybody know where I can source wind up music mechanisms for music boxes.

    There is also a company called Klockit. They specialize in clock kits, but they have some music box stuff too.
